Palantir Technologies (PLTR) is currently trading at $136.6, reflecting a slight decline of 0.20% in the latest session. The stock remains above a critical support level at $129.77, while facing resistance near $143.43. This narrow trading range suggests a period of consolidation as the market weighs recent sector trends and company-specific catalysts.

The marginal decline of 0.20% to $136.6 indicates that Palantir is experiencing a pause following its prior upward momentum. Trading volume during the session appeared consistent with normal activity, suggesting no panic selling or aggressive accumulation. Palantir operates in the high-growth artificial intelligence and data analytics sector, which has seen heightened investor interest over the past year. However, recent sector rotation and macroeconomic uncertainty—including interest rate expectations—may be contributing to the stock’s current consolidation. The company has benefited from strong government and commercial contracts, yet profit-taking after extended rallies is not uncommon. The lack of a decisive move below support or through resistance implies that traders are awaiting further catalysts, such as upcoming earnings reports or major partnership announcements. The stock’s relative position within the tech sector remains robust, with Palantir often viewed as a bellwether for AI-driven enterprise software. From a technical perspective, Palantir’s price action shows it is trading between a well-defined support level at $129.77 and a resistance zone at $143.43. The recent near-unchanged price indicates a tug-of-war between buyers and sellers. Short-term moving averages—such as the 20-day and 50-day—may be converging, reflecting a loss in directional momentum. Momentum indicators like the Relative Strength Index (RSI) are likely in the neutral range, perhaps between 40 and 60, suggesting neither overbought nor oversold conditions. The stock has been forming a tight trading range over the past few sessions, which often precedes a more significant breakout or breakdown. Without a strong catalyst, the price may continue to oscillate within these boundaries. A move above $143.43 would signal renewed bullish strength, while a drop below $129.77 could invite further downside toward the next major support level. The overall trend remains positive on a longer-term basis, but near-term indecision is evident. Going forward, Palantir’s price trajectory will likely hinge on several key factors. A sustained break above the $143.43 resistance could see the stock challenging higher levels, possibly revisiting prior highs. Conversely, if selling pressure increases and the $129.77 support fails, the stock may test lower zones around $120 or the 100-day moving average. Upcoming earnings reports, changes in government spending on defense and AI, and broader market sentiment toward high-growth tech stocks will be important catalysts. Any news regarding new large contracts or strategic partnerships could provide a positive spark. However, if macroeconomic headwinds—such as rising interest rates or a tech sector rotation—intensify, Palantir may face additional headwinds. Traders should monitor volume patterns for confirmation of any breakout or breakdown. The current equilibrium suggests the market is waiting for clearer signals before making a directional bet.
